Sheet Moulding Compound (SMC) is sheet material for hot press mould. The SMC process is the most important process technology for fiber reinforced polymers today. SMC is a mixture of polymer resin, fillers, fiber reinforcement, catalysts, pigment and stabilizers, release agents, and thickeners. Manufacture of SMC is a continuous in-line process. The material is sheathed both top and bottom with a polyethylene or nylon plastic film to prevent auto-adhesion. The resin paste is spread uniformly onto the bottom film. Chopped glass fibers are randomly deposited onto the paste. The top film is introduced and the sandwich is rolled into a pre-determined thickness. The sheet is allowed to mature for 48 hours before shipment. Heat represents one of the most difficult environments for a polymer. The cross-link reaction of covalent bonds that takes place when polyester thermoset is molded gives SMC compounds a distinct structural advantage over alternative materials, such as thermoplastic, at elevated temperatures. Relaxation or creep failure is far less in a chemically reacted thermoset composite than a “cooled to form” (cold pressed/hand lay-up) thermoplastic materials.
